Assistant Men's & Women's Water Polo Coach
Position Summary:
This position assists the Head Men's and Women's Water Polo Coach during practices and games (at least 60%); assists with various tasks associated with recruiting while adhering to the CWPA, WWPA, and NCAA regulations. In addition, assists with equipment management and general record keeping. Must be able to support and promote the University's Mission.
1. Assists head coach with team training and various administrative responsibilities including, but not limited to, fundraising, community service, and recruiting.
2. Assists with monitoring study tables.
3. Assists with various practice and game-related duties.
4. Understands and complies with all NCAA and Gannon University regulations.
5. Assists in the development and implementation of camps and clinics.
6. Performs other duties as assigned within the scope and responsibility and requirements of the job.
Required Qualifications:
Must have excellent written and verbal communication skills; demonstrated organizational and time management skills; and the ability to effectively assist with teaching and coaching swimming and water polo skills and strategy.
Must have prior playing or coaching experience, preferably at the college level.
Must have a valid driver’s license in good standing.
